What the supplied records establish

A retained payment-compatibility record describes the Australian payment landscape as restrictive. It reports that Visa and Mastercard deposits have a high failure rate because of Australian bank blocks, while listing Neosurf, MiFinity, and cryptocurrency options including BTC, ETH, LTC, and DOGE. The same record labels Neosurf and cryptocurrency as recommended options in the stored analysis.

That wording should be read as attributed research, not as an independent test of current payment acceptance. It indicates that the stored comparison data identified several payment routes for Australian players, but it does not establish that every route will work for every user, bank, device, or session. It also does not establish that a mobile screen presents these methods in a particular order or format.

A second retained record compares advertised withdrawal times with reported outcomes. It states that cryptocurrency was advertised as “instant”, while the reported reality was one to four hours after KYC. It also records a tested small LTC withdrawal that was processed in 45 minutes. For bank transfers, the record contrasts an advertised one-to-three-day period with a reported five-to-nine-business-day period.

These figures are not equivalent kinds of evidence. The “advertised” periods describe marketing or published expectations in the stored research. The one-to-four-hour and five-to-nine-business-day ranges are reported outcomes from player-report analysis. The 45-minute LTC example is described as a test within that record, but one test does not establish a universal processing time.

A further payment record states that the minimum withdrawal was reported as $20 AUD for cryptocurrency and was often $50–$100 AUD for bank transfers. It also reports maximum withdrawal limits of $4,000 AUD per day and $15,000 AUD per month, citing withdrawal-limit terms accessed on 20 May 2024. How a card-funded withdrawal is described

The stored payment scenario examines a player who wins $500 after using a bonus on a Visa card. It states that the player cannot withdraw to Visa and must select bank transfer instead. The scenario then describes a request for a bank statement dated within 90 days, followed by processing of 24–48 hours and a transfer period of five to seven business days. Its estimate is approximately nine days in total.

This scenario is useful because it shows why a mobile payment experience cannot be judged only by the deposit screen. The route from deposit to withdrawal may involve a different payment method, an additional document request, a processing stage, and a bank-transfer stage. In the stored record, the journey is therefore not simply a matter of selecting “withdraw” and receiving funds through the original card.

The scenario is explicitly framed around a bonus-funded win and should not be expanded into a universal rule for every account or payment route. It does not establish that every Visa deposit creates the same outcome, nor does it establish that the same timeline applies to cryptocurrency or Neosurf. It is best read as one described payment case that illustrates a possible change of route and a longer bank-transfer process.
